    Comments Thread For: Pacquiao Says He Wants to Help Train, 'Supervise' Naoya Inoue As He Moves Up In Weight

    Manny Pacquiao apparently sees a lot of himself in Naoya Inoue. To the point that the eight-division champion and former senator of the Philippines wants to help what many feel today is the world's greatest fighter.
